#4f1b83 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f1b83 is composed of 31% red, 10.6%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.7% cyan, 79.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 270 degrees, a saturation of 65.8% and a lightness of 31%. #4f1b83 color hex could be obtained by blending #9e36ff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#4f1b83 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f1b83 has RGB values of R:79, G:27,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0.79,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 5184387.
